#0f3106 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0f3106 is composed of 5.9% red, 19.2%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 87.8%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 107.4 degrees, a saturation of 78.2% and a lightness of 10.8%. #0f3106 color hex could be obtained by blending #1e620c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

● #0f3106 color description : Very dark (mostly black) lime green.
#0f3106 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0f3106 has RGB values of R:15, G:49, B:6 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:0, Y:0.88,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 995590.
